Abstract
本实用新型公开一种混凝土试块打磨装置,包括打磨机体、可伸缩支架和底座。打磨机体包括可伸缩打磨机身、把手、电机和磨片。可伸缩打磨机身由内外筒组成,内外筒之间通过螺栓连接。把手焊接在电机上呈40度角,电机和可伸缩打磨机身通过铁片连接,磨片与主轴通过螺丝压板连接,与电机通过主轴连接。接通电源后,电机通过传动装置带动磨片进行打磨作业。可伸缩支架由内筒和外筒组成,内外筒之间通过螺栓连接。可伸缩支架和打磨机体通过定位销连接。底座包括圆水准器、平板和水平调节螺母。底座和可伸缩支架通过轴承连接。打磨作业时,将混凝土试块放置在保持水平可底座上,工作人员手持把手,开通电源,依靠轴承和可伸缩打磨机身完成打磨作业。
The utility model discloses a concrete test block grinding device, which comprises a grinding machine body, a telescopic bracket and a base. The grinding body includes a retractable grinding body, a handle, a motor and a grinding disc. The retractable grinding body is composed of inner and outer cylinders, which are connected by bolts. The handle is welded on the motor at an angle of 40 degrees, the motor and the retractable grinding body are connected by iron sheets, the grinding sheet is connected to the main shaft by a screw pressure plate, and connected to the motor by a main shaft. After the power is turned on, the motor drives the grinding disc through the transmission device to perform the grinding operation. The telescopic bracket is composed of an inner cylinder and an outer cylinder, and the inner and outer cylinders are connected by bolts. The telescopic support and the grinding machine body are connected by positioning pins. Base includes circular level, plate and leveling nut. The base and the telescopic support are connected by bearings. During the grinding operation, the concrete test block is placed on a horizontal base, the staff holds the handle, turns on the power supply, and completes the grinding operation relying on the bearing and the retractable grinding body.

背景技术Background technique
建筑工程试验装备领域中,往往需要制作混凝土试块进行试验,制作的混凝土试块表面往往会凹凸不平,所以需对混凝土试块进行打磨。在对混凝土试块进行打磨的过程中,以往的打磨工具一般为手持式。该类手持式打磨工具在打磨过程中受人为因素影响较大,打磨精度较低。由于打磨的不平整,在试验过程中混凝土试块易产生应力集中的现象,从而影响试验结果的精度。此外,该类手持式打磨工具对工作人员的技术娴熟度也有较高的要求,如工作人员对手持式打磨机操作不熟悉,还容易引起人身伤害事故的发生。由于上述情况的存在,目前建筑工程试验装备领域急需一种固定式混凝土打磨装置来对标准混凝土试件进行打磨。In the field of construction engineering test equipment, it is often necessary to make concrete test blocks for testing. The surface of the manufactured concrete test blocks is often uneven, so the concrete test blocks need to be polished. In the process of grinding the concrete test block, the grinding tools in the past are generally hand-held. Such hand-held grinding tools are greatly affected by human factors during the grinding process, and the grinding accuracy is low. Due to the uneven grinding, the concrete test block is prone to stress concentration during the test process, which affects the accuracy of the test results. In addition, such hand-held grinding tools also have high requirements for the technical proficiency of the staff. If the staff is not familiar with the operation of the hand-held grinding machine, it is easy to cause personal injury accidents. Due to the existence of the above situation, a fixed concrete grinding device is urgently needed in the field of construction engineering test equipment to grind standard concrete specimens.

本实用新型的工作原理为:The working principle of the utility model is:
底座和可伸缩支架通过轴承连接,可以使支架和打磨机体水平向自由旋转,可伸缩支架根据混凝土试块的高度而选择内筒伸缩长度,使磨片下表面与放置在底座上的混凝土试块上表面接触。进行打磨作业时,工作人员手持打磨机体上的把手,拧开可伸缩打磨机身上的螺栓,令其可以自由伸缩,通过电机带动磨片进行打磨作业。The base and the telescopic support are connected by bearings, which can make the support and the grinding body rotate freely in the horizontal direction. The telescopic support selects the telescopic length of the inner cylinder according to the height of the concrete test block, so that the lower surface of the grinding plate and the concrete test block placed on the base contact with the upper surface. When performing the grinding operation, the staff holds the handle on the grinding body and unscrews the bolts on the retractable grinding body so that it can expand and contract freely, and the grinding plate is driven by the motor to perform the grinding operation.
本实用新型的有益效果为:The beneficial effects of the utility model are:
(1)通过设置底座、水平调节螺母和圆水准器,可以使混凝土试块处于水平进行打磨,控制了打磨误差,提高了打磨精度;(1) By setting the base, the level adjustment nut and the circular level, the concrete test block can be ground horizontally, which controls the grinding error and improves the grinding accuracy;
(2)底座和可伸缩支架通过轴承连接,可伸缩支架可以带动通过定位销连接的打磨机体水平向自由旋转180度,手持把手,可以水平向旋转伸缩的对混凝土试块进行打磨,灵活实用;(2) The base and the telescopic bracket are connected by bearings, and the telescopic bracket can drive the grinding body connected by the positioning pin to rotate freely 180 degrees in the horizontal direction, and hold the handle to grind the concrete test block horizontally and flexibly, which is flexible and practical;
(3)可伸缩支架给角磨机提供了支撑,减小了工作人员的手持力度,不仅省力,还降低了人身事故的发生率。(3) The telescopic bracket provides support for the angle grinder, which reduces the hand-holding strength of the staff, which not only saves labor, but also reduces the incidence of personal accidents.

如图1所示,一种混凝土试块打磨装置,包括底座1-1、可伸缩支架1-2、打磨机体1-3;其中,所述的底座1-1通过轴承1-5与可伸缩支架1-2相连接,可伸缩支架1-2垂直于所述的底座1-1;打磨机体1-3的可伸缩打磨机身5-1垂直于所述的可伸缩支架1-2;其中:底座1-1固定,可伸缩支架1-2可自由水平向旋转180度,打磨机体1-3与可伸缩支架1-2通过定位销1-4相连接,限制了打磨机体相对可伸缩支架的移动和转动,但由于可伸缩支架可水平向旋转,打磨机体可以随之水平向旋转相同角度。As shown in Fig. 1, a kind of concrete test block polishing device comprises base 1-1, telescopic support 1-2, polishing body 1-3; Wherein, described base 1-1 connects telescopic The brackets 1-2 are connected, and the telescopic bracket 1-2 is perpendicular to the base 1-1; the telescopic grinding body 5-1 of the grinding body 1-3 is perpendicular to the telescopic bracket 1-2; wherein : The base 1-1 is fixed, the telescopic bracket 1-2 can freely rotate 180 degrees horizontally, the grinding body 1-3 is connected with the telescopic bracket 1-2 through the positioning pin 1-4, which limits the relative telescopic bracket of the grinding body However, since the telescopic bracket can rotate horizontally, the grinding body can rotate horizontally at the same angle.
如图2所示,底座1-1包括水平调节螺母2-1,圆水准器2-2和平板2-3,平板的四个角各有一个螺纹孔,水平调节螺母2-1通过螺纹孔与平板2-3相连接,圆水准器2-2内嵌在平板2-4内,调节水平调节螺母2-1至圆水准器2-2中的气泡居中,则底座1-1水平。将混凝土试快水平放置在底座上,减少了打磨误差。As shown in Figure 2, the base 1-1 includes a level adjustment nut 2-1, a circular level 2-2 and a plate 2-3, each of the four corners of the plate has a threaded hole, and the level adjustment nut 2-1 passes through the threaded hole Connected with the flat plate 2-3, the circular vial 2-2 is embedded in the flat plate 2-4, and the level adjustment nut 2-1 is adjusted until the air bubble in the circular vial 2-2 is centered, then the base 1-1 is level. Place the concrete test block horizontally on the base, reducing grinding errors.
如图3所示,可伸缩支架1-2由实心内筒3-1和空心外筒3-3组成,外筒3-3上有三处螺纹孔,通过螺栓3-2穿过螺纹孔可将内外筒固定住,拧开螺栓3-2可自由水平向伸缩。在底座1-1放置混凝土试块后,拧开螺栓3-2,调节支架高度使磨片4-6下表面与混凝土试块上表面紧贴,即可拧紧螺栓3-2固定内筒3-1的位置。内筒3-1顶部有一个销钉孔3-4,可伸缩支架1-2与打磨机体1-3通过定位销1-4穿过销钉孔3-4相连接的。As shown in Figure 3, the telescopic bracket 1-2 is made up of a solid inner cylinder 3-1 and a hollow outer cylinder 3-3, and there are three threaded holes on the outer cylinder 3-3, through which the bolt 3-2 can pass through the threaded holes. The inner and outer cylinders are fixed, and the bolts 3-2 are unscrewed to expand and contract freely horizontally. After placing the concrete test block on the base 1-1, unscrew the bolt 3-2, adjust the height of the support so that the lower surface of the grinding plate 4-6 is close to the upper surface of the concrete test block, and then tighten the bolt 3-2 to fix the inner cylinder 3- 1 position. There is a pin hole 3-4 at the top of the inner cylinder 3-1, and the telescopic support 1-2 is connected with the grinding body 1-3 through the pin hole 3-4 by the positioning pin 1-4.
如图4、图5和图6所示,打磨机体1-3包括可伸缩打磨机身5-1、把手4-4、电机4-5和磨片4-6;电机4-5的驱动轴的轴线与可伸缩支架1-2平行;可伸缩打磨机身5-1包括实心内筒4-1和空心外筒4-2,外筒4-2上有三处螺纹孔,内外筒之间通过螺栓4-3穿过螺纹孔相连接,拧紧螺栓4-3即可固定内外筒,拧开可自由伸缩。把手4-4焊接在电机顶部且倾斜40度。可伸缩打磨机身5-1通过铁片5-3与电机4-5相连接,铁片5-3一端焊接在电机4-5上,另一端与可伸缩打磨机身通过螺栓4-3穿过铁片5-3和可伸缩打磨机身相通的螺纹孔连接。电机4-5通过主轴6-1与磨片4-6连接,主轴6-1与磨片4-6通过螺丝压板6-2连接,磨片4-6可拆卸,拧开螺丝压板6-2即可卸下磨片4-6,装上磨片4-6后拧紧螺丝压板6-2即可使用。As shown in Fig. 4, Fig. 5 and Fig. 6, the grinding body 1-3 comprises a retractable grinding body 5-1, a handle 4-4, a motor 4-5 and a grinding disc 4-6; the drive shaft of the motor 4-5 The axis of the shaft is parallel to the telescopic support 1-2; the telescopic grinding body 5-1 includes a solid inner cylinder 4-1 and a hollow outer cylinder 4-2, and there are three threaded holes on the outer cylinder 4-2, and the inner and outer cylinders pass through The bolts 4-3 are connected through the threaded holes, the inner and outer cylinders can be fixed by tightening the bolts 4-3, and can be freely stretched when unscrewed. The handle 4-4 is welded on the top of the motor and inclined at 40 degrees. The retractable grinding body 5-1 is connected with the motor 4-5 through the iron sheet 5-3, and one end of the iron sheet 5-3 is welded on the motor 4-5, and the other end and the retractable grinding body are worn through the bolt 4-3. Connect through the threaded hole that the iron sheet 5-3 communicates with the retractable grinding body. The motor 4-5 is connected to the grinding disc 4-6 through the main shaft 6-1, the main shaft 6-1 is connected to the grinding disc 4-6 through the screw pressure plate 6-2, the grinding disc 4-6 is detachable, unscrew the screw pressure plate 6-2 The grinding disc 4-6 can be unloaded, and the screw pressing plate 6-2 can be used by tightening the screw pressing plate 6-2 after loading onto the grinding disc 4-6.
进行打磨作业时,手持把手4-4,拧开固定内筒4-1、外筒4-2的螺栓,使内、外筒可以水平自由伸缩,因为轴承1-5的带动,可伸缩打磨机身5-1还可以水平向旋转,根据电机4-5通过传动装置带动磨片4-6旋转,即可实现对混凝土试块的打磨。When performing grinding operations, hold the handle 4-4 and unscrew the bolts fixing the inner cylinder 4-1 and the outer cylinder 4-2, so that the inner and outer cylinders can be horizontally and freely stretched, because the bearing 1-5 drives the retractable grinding machine The body 5-1 can also rotate horizontally. According to the rotation of the grinding disc 4-6 driven by the motor 4-5 through the transmission device, the grinding of the concrete test block can be realized.
综上所述,将混凝土试块放置在已经调平的底座上,调平的标志是圆水准器中的气泡居中。拧开可伸缩支架上的螺栓,调整高度,使磨片与混凝土试块紧贴,然后拧紧螺栓,固定可伸缩支架高度。拧开可伸缩打磨机身上的螺栓,使其可以水平自由伸缩,并因为底座和可伸缩支架通过轴承连接,而可以水平向自由旋转180度,手持把手,接通电源,电机开始工作,带动磨片旋转对混凝土试块进行打磨,该装置用于打磨混凝土试块,灵活实用且提高了打磨精度。To sum up, the concrete test block is placed on the base that has been leveled, and the sign of leveling is that the air bubble in the circular level is centered. Unscrew the bolts on the telescopic bracket, adjust the height so that the grinding disc is close to the concrete test block, and then tighten the bolts to fix the height of the telescopic bracket. Unscrew the bolts on the telescopic grinding body, so that it can be extended and extended freely horizontally, and because the base and the telescopic bracket are connected by bearings, they can freely rotate 180 degrees horizontally, hold the handle, turn on the power, the motor starts to work, and drives The grinding disc rotates to grind the concrete test block, and the device is used for grinding the concrete test block, which is flexible and practical and improves the grinding accuracy.
